Summary
In this episode, Craig from Flying Wheels shares his journey in the auto detailing industry, discussing the changes in detailing practices, the impact of social media, and the importance of quality over price. He emphasizes the value of building relationships with clients and the significance of problem-solving in achieving success. Craig also reflects on the differences between old school and new school detailers, and how learning from both successes and failures can lead to growth in the industry.
Takeaways
- Craig started his journey in auto detailing by trial and error.
- The detailing industry has changed with the influence of social media.
- Old school detailers focus on craftsmanship and attention to detail.
- New school detailers often rely on online resources for learning.
- Quality of work is more important than the price charged.
- Building relationships with clients leads to repeat business.
- Problem-solving is a key skill for success in the industry.
- Detailing is about addressing deal breakers for customers.
- Learning from mistakes is essential for growth.
- Community support is vital for new entrepreneurs in the detailing business.
